7 Home Remedies for stomach upset
upset stomach is a common thing that can occur due to poor digestion or slow digestion. There are numerous other reasons that can lead to stomach pain like poison food allergic to certain foods, depression, excessive alcohol consumption, infection and pregnancy. The consequences of this problem is serious. It can lead to upset stomach and throbbing, nausea, vomiting, diarrhea or loose motion and heartburn. Instead of always looking for solutions to the medical stores, you can opt for home remedies that are safe and free of side effects.
Here is a list of beneficial home remedies for stomach problems Malaise:
1. Apple cider vinegar:
This vinegar has a high amount of pectin that can reduce stomachache in a stepwise manner. In addition, the acidic nature can heal stomach cells and aids made in allowing them to return to normal. Take a glass of hot or warm water and add a teaspoon of apple cider vinegar in it. Honey can be added which is optional. Drink this solution at least 3 times a day to get some relief.
2. Mint tea:
mint leaves are useful in handling matters stomach pain, because it contains phytonutrients that can unleash the flow of bile and improve our digestive cycle. Get fresh mint leaves and extract juice from it. Add a teaspoon of mint juice in a little warm water with a teaspoon of honey and drink it. Peppermint tea can reduce nausea and dizziness caused by stomach upset.
3. Chamomile tea:
This herb can relax tense muscles and cells lining the stomach our digestive tract. Chamomile is available in powder form of tea or you can get fresh chamomile flowers shops Ayurveda. Add a teaspoon of this to a cup of hot water and let stand for a while. Strain and drink the solution. Have at least 3-4 cups of this tea every day to earn some improvement.
4. Ginger:
The ginger has been used since ancient times as a remedy for many diseases. Simply cut a small piece of ginger and chew for a while before swallowing. Alternatively, drinking a hot cup of ginger tea when you have an upset stomach. It is better to opt for ginger root. Ginger contains compounds that can reduce the effects of stomach problems. It is also anti-inflammatory.
5. Fennel seeds:
Moler partially a teaspoon fennel seeds and add it to a cup of warm water. Allow to soak for 10-15 minutes before straining and drinking the solution. Fennel seeds can ignite the discharge of digestive fluids that can improve our digestive process. Another advantage of this seed is that it has both anti-bacterial and anti-spasmodic properties.
6. fenugreek seeds
fenugreek seeds can be considered as an ideal solution for this because it provides immediate relief. Grind 2 teaspoons powdered fenugreek seeds. Add in a glass of water and drink the mixture twice a day. The seeds contain a compound called mucilage, which can prevent loose movement by hardening of the stool.
7. Yoghurt:
Having 2-3 cups of yogurt daily until the stomachache disappears. It is better to buy yogurt contains bacteria cultures that can give immediate relief. Some people prefer the addition of bananas that can alleviate this problem as banana contains pectin, which can harden the feces immediately. They include yogurt as part of your meal every day to prevent the onset of stomach pain.
